    2.5.1.1 Flooding v cc bin th

    Flooding l mt k thut chung thng dng trong pht tn thng tin v tm

    ng trong mng c dy v khng dy ad hoc. Chin thut nh tuyn n gin v

    khng i hi cu hnh mng tn km v thut ton tm ng phc tp. Flooding

    dng phng php reactive (phn ng li), khi mi node nhn c mt gi iu

    H Tn Hi K14TMT Trang 33

  • 7/31/2019 KHA LUN TT NGHIP H TN HI chnh sa

    42/71

    Tm hiu mt s giao thc nh tuyn trong mng cm bin khng dy

    khin hay d liu n s gi n tt c cc node xung quanh n. Sau khi truyn, mt

    gi i theo tt c cc ng c th c. Nu khng b mt kt ni, gi s n ch.

    Hn na, khi cu hnh mng thay i, vic truyn gi s theo nhng tuyn mi. Hnh

    2.3 minh ha qui c flooding trong mng. Flooding dng n gin nht c th lmcc gi b sao chp li mt cch khng gii hn khi i qua cc node mng.

    ngn chn mt gi tin i vng khng xc nh trong mng, mt trng gi

    l hop count c them v gi. u tin,hop count c t gi tr sp s ng knh

    mng. Khi gi i qua mng,hop count b gim i 1 sau mi bc (1 bc c tnh

    t 1 ln truyn t node ny sang node kia). Khi hop count v 0,gi s b b i. Mt

    cch tng t c dng l thm vo trng time-to-live,trng ny ghi li thi gianm gi c php tn ti trong mng, khi ht thi gian ny, gi khng c truyn i

    na. Flooding c th c ci tin bng cch x nhn gi d liu duy nht, mi node

    mng s b i cc gi nhn ri.

    Mc d s n gin trong qui lut hot ng v ph hp vi cu hnh mng c

    chi ph thp nhng flooding gp nhiu bt li khi p dng cho mng WSNs. Nhc

    in u tin ca flooding l gp phi vn traffic implosion (bng n hay khp kn

    2.5.1.2 Giao thc nh tuyn thng tin qua s tha thun

    Giao thc thng tin qua s tha thun gia cc node (SPIN) l h cc giao

    thc da trn tha thun pht thng tin trong mng WSN. i tng chnh ca cc

    giao thc ny l tnh hiu qu ca vic pht thng tin t mt node no n tt c

    cc node khc trong mng. Cc giao thc n gin nht l flooding v gossiping.

    Flooding i hi mi node gi mt bn sao gi d liu n tt c cc node ln cn

    vi n cho n khi thng tin n c ch. Gossiping dng tnh ngu nhin gim

    s bn sao v yu cu ch c mt node nhn mt gi d liu v sau chuyn

    tip mt cch ngu nhin n mt node c chn trc.

    S n gin ca flooding v gossiping do qui lut hot ng n gin v

    khng i hi cu hnh phc tp. Tuy nhin, c im cc giao thc ny l s tr gi

    lm gim cht lng mng v lu lng ti, gy ra bi s bng n cc gi v chng

    ln cc gi trong cng vng phn b. Cc giao thc n gin nh flooding v

    gossiping khng tnh n ngun nng lng hin ti lm gim mt cch ng k thi

    gian sng ca mng. i tng chnh ca nhm giao thc SPIN l gii quyt hn ch

    ca cc giao thc truyn thng. Nguyn l c bn ca h giao thc ny l tha thun

    d liu v s thch nghi ti nguyn mng. Tha thun d liu (data negotiation) yucu cc node phi hc ni dung ca d liu trc khi pht d liu gia cc node

    mng. SPIN dng cc gi nh l m t trc khi pht gi d liu thc. Cc node thu

    khi nhn c gi qung co nu mun nhn gi d liu thc phi gi mt gi yu

    cu cho node ngun. Do gi d liu thc ch c gi cho cc gi quan tm, hn

    ch kh nng b bng n gi nh trong flooding v gim ng k lu lng d tha

    trong mng. Ngoi ra vic dng kha m t d liu (meta data descriptors) loi tr

    kh nng chng ln v cc node ch yu cu d liu cn quan tm.

    S thch ng ti nguyn mng (Resource adaptation) cho php cc node dng

    giao thc SPIN iu chnh hot ng theo trng thi hin nng lng hin ti. Mi

    node trong mng c th theo di s tiu th nng lng trc khi pht hay x l d

    liu. Khi mc nng lng xung thp, node s gim hay ngng hon ton cc hotng nh chuyn tip gi cho cc node khc. Vic ny s c cc node cn nng

    lng nhiu hn thc hin. SPIN gip ko di thi gian sng ca node.

    SPIN thc hin vic tha thun v truyn d liu thng qua 3 dng thng

    ip. u tin l gi ADV, c dng qung co cho gi d liu mi m node

    mun pht. Node c d liu s pht cc gi ADV cha m t d liu thc n cc

    node xung quanh. Dng th 2 l gi REQ, c dng yu cu node ngun pht gi

    d liu qung co trc . Mt node mng nhn c gi ADV v th hin

    mong mun nhn gi d liu thc bng cch pht i thng ip REQ. Dng th 3 l

    DATA, cha d liu thc. Gi DATA thng ln hn cc gi ADV v REQ. Vic

    hn ch cc gi d tha lm gim ng k nng lng tiu th ti cc node.

    Hot ng c bn ca giao thc SPIN c minh ha trn hnh 2.7. Node

    ngun l A, pht gi ADV qung co gi d liu m n mun pht. Node B nhn

    c gi ADV ny. Node B th hin mong mun nhn gi d liu c qung co

    theo nh m t trong gi ADV. V th B gi gi REQ cho A. Sau A gi gi dliu thc cho B. Node B sau khi nhn d liu li pht gi ADV cho cc node

    C,D,E,F,G. Ch c 3 node C,E,G quan tm n gi ny. Cc node ny pht thng ip

    REQ cho node B. Ngay sau B gi d liu cho C,E,G. Qu trnh din ra cho n

    khi gi d liu n c ch mong mun.

    Hnh 2.8.Th tc bt tay trong giao thc SPIN-PP

    Dng n gin nht ca h giao thc SPIN l SPIN-PP, c thit k cho

    mng lin lc im-im (point-to-point). Th tc bt tay ba bc nh trn hnh 2.8.

    Bc 1, node A c d liu cn pht v th A pht gi ADV qung co cho gi d liu

    thc ca mnh. Bc 2, node B quan tm n gi d liu thc lin gi gi REQ

    yu cu d liu. Bc 3, node A p ng yu cu v gi gi d liu thc cho B.

    Giao thc ny tha thun gia cc node trnh nguy c b bng n cc gi v vn

    chng ln trong giao thc flooding v gossiping. Theo m phng hiu qu gp 3.5

    ln so vi flooding. Giao thc cn t tc d liu cao gn ti u so vi l thuyt.

    Mt loi khc l SPIN-EC, kt hp k thut quan st ngun nng lng datrn mc ngng. Mt node ch tham gia vo hot ng giao thc nu node c th

    hon thnh tt c cc hot ng m khng lm gim nng lng di mc cho php.

    Khi node nhn c mt gi qung co, n khng gi thng ip REQ nu n xc

    nh ngun nng lng khng gi gi REQ v nhn gi DATA. Kt qu m

    phng cho thy giao thc SPIN-EC tng 60% d liu trn mt n v nng lng so

    vi flooding.

    C SPIN-PP v SPIN-EC iu c thit k cho lin lc im-dim. Mt loi

    th 3, SPIN-BC c thit k cho mng qung b. Trong cc loi mng ny, tt c

    cc node dng chung mt knh truyn. Khi mt node gi mt gi d liu qua knh

    qung b, gi s c nhn bi tt c cc node khc trong phm vi ca node. Giaothc SPIN-BC khng yu cu cc node sau khi nhn thng ip ADV phi p li

    ngay lp tc gi REQ. Thay vo node ch mt khong thi gian, trong khi n

    gim st knh truyn. Nu node nghe thy thng ip REQ c pht ra t mt node

    khc (ngha l node kia mong mun nhn c gi d liu t node ngun), node s

    hy gi yu cu ca n, do loi b kh nng cc gi REQ d tha trong mng. Khi

    nhn c gi REQ t mt node no trong mng, node ngun s gi thng ip

    DATA ch mt ln, mc d c th n nhn nhiu gi yu cu ging nhau t cc node

    mng.

    Hot ng c bn ca giao thc SPIN-BC c miu t trn hnh 2.9. Trong

    m hnh ny, node c d liu l node A, gi mt gi ADV gii thiu d liu ca

    n cho cc node ln cn. Tt c cc node nghe thy thng ip ny, nhng node C

    pht trc gi REQ yu cu gi d liu t node A. V y l gi pht qung b

    nn cc node B v D nghe c gi ny v ngng vic pht gi REQ ca n. Node E

    v F khng quan tm v b qua cc gi ny. Khi nghe c gi REQ t node C, node

    A pht gi d liu cho C. Tt c cc node iu nhn c gi ny. Trong mi trng

    qung b, SPIN-BC gim hao ph nng lng bng cch hn ch cc gi d tha

    trong mng.

    2.5.1.3 Truyn tin trc tip (Directed Diffusion)

    y l giao thc trung tm d liu i vi vic truyn v phn b thng tin

    trong mng cm bin khng dy. Mc tiu chnh l tit kim nng lng tng thi

    gian sng ca mng t c mc tiu ny, giao thc ny gi tng tc gia cc

    nt cm bin, da vo vic trao i cc bn tin, nh v trong vng ln cn mng. S

    dng s tng tc v v tr nhn thy c tp hp ti thiu cc ng truyn dn. c

    im duy nht ca giao thc ny l s kt hp vi kh nng ca nt c th tp

    trung d liu p ng truy vn ca sink tit kim nng lng. Thnh phn chnh

    ca giao thc ny bao gm 4 thnh phn: interest (thng tin yu cu), data message

    (cc bn tin d liu), gradient, reinforcements. Directed disffusion s dng m hnhpublish- and subcribe trong mt ngi kim tra (ti sink) s miu t mi quan tm

    (interest) bng mt cp thuc tnh-gi tr.

    2.5.1.6 GEAR (Geographic and Energy Aware Routing)

    Giao thc GEAR (Geographic and Energy-Aware Routing) dng s nhn bit

    v nng lng v cc phng php thng bo thng tin v a l ti cc node ln cn.

    Vic nh tuyn thng tin theo vng a l rt c ch trong cc h thng xc nh v

    tr, c bit l trong mng cm bin. tng ny hn ch s lng cc yu cu

    Directed Diffusion bng cch quan tm n mt vng xc nh hn l gi cc yu cu

    ti ton mng. GEAR ci tin hn Directed Diffusion im ny v v th d tr

    c nhiu nng lng hn.Trong giao thc GEAR, mi mt node gi mt estimated cost v mt learned

    cost trong qu trnh n ch qua cc node ln cn. Estimated cost l s kt hp ca

    nng lng cn d v khong cch n ch. Learned cost l s ci tin ca estimated

    cost gii thch cho vic nh tuyn xung quanh cc hc trong mng. Hc xy ra khi

    m mt node khng c bt k mt node ln cn no gn hn so vi vng ch hn l

    chnh n, trong trng hp khng c mt hc no th estimated cost bng vi learned

    cost. Learned cost c truyn ngc li 1 hop mi ln mt gi n ch lm cho
